在SQL中存储记录以进行访问/性能查询的最佳方式是使用数据库管理系统(DBMS)来管理和操作数据。DBMS是一个软件系统,用于创建、操作和维护数据库。
以下是在SQL中存储记录以进行访问/性能查询的最佳实践:
- 数据库设计:
- 根据业务需求和数据关系设计数据库模式。使用范式化设计减少数据冗余和提高数据一致性。
- 定义适当的表和表字段,确保每个字段具有适当的数据类型和长度,以减少存储空间和提高查询效率。
- 索引:
- 创建适当的索引以加快数据检索和查询速度。索引可以基于单个字段或多个字段组合创建。
- 避免过度索引,因为索引的维护也需要消耗资源,可能影响写入性能。
- 分区:
- 如果数据库表的数据量庞大,可以考虑对表进行分区。分区可以提高查询性能,同时降低备份和恢复的时间成本。
- 优化查询:
- 使用合适的查询语句,避免全表扫描和不必要的数据加载。
- 编写高效的SQL查询语句,使用合适的连接和过滤条件。
- 对于频繁执行的查询,考虑使用缓存机制或视图来提高性能。
- 数据库性能调优:
- 定期分析和监控数据库性能,使用数据库管理工具进行性能优化和调整。
- 调整数据库参数,如缓冲区大小、并发连接数等,以最大程度地利用硬件资源。
腾讯云的相关产品和服务:
- 云数据库 TencentDB:提供云上关系型数据库服务,支持MySQL、SQL Server、PostgreSQL、MariaDB等多种数据库类型。链接:https://cloud.tencent.com/product/cdb
- 分布式数据库 TDSQL:提供高性能、高可用性的分布式关系型数据库服务。支持MySQL、PostgreSQL,并提供一体化的数据管理能力。链接:https://cloud.tencent.com/product/tdsql
- 云数据库 TcaplusDB:一种适用于海量数据存储和高性能查询的多模型分布式数据库。链接:https://cloud.tencent.com/product/tdsql
请注意,以上提到的产品仅为示例,并不是对云计算品牌商的提及。在实际应用中,根据具体需求和业务场景选择适合的云计算平台和服务供应商。